France to South Africa: What You Need to Know

South Africa offers visa-free entry to French passport holders for up to 90 days for tourism, business, or transit. This is one of Africa's most accessible destinations for French travellers, with excellent flight connections from Paris Charles de Gaulle.

French citizens should ensure their passport has at least 30 days validity beyond their intended departure date and at least two blank pages for the entry stamp. Minors travelling to South Africa face additional documentation requirements (birth certificate and parental consent).

South Africa uses the South African rand (ZAR). The currency is relatively weak against the euro, making South Africa affordable for French visitors.

Practical Tips

South Africa uses the South African rand (ZAR), which is favourable against the euro. Driving is on the left. Cape Town and Johannesburg are the main entry points. Do not rent a car without adequate insurance. Safari destinations (Kruger National Park, private game reserves) require advance booking.

Do French citizens need vaccinations for South Africa?

No routine vaccinations are required for entry. However, malaria prophylaxis is recommended if visiting the Kruger National Park or Limpopo province. Yellow fever vaccination is required if arriving from a yellow fever endemic country.
